More pics of interesting hawk

Here are two more pics of the interesting hawk I saw at Cheyenne Bottoms earlier this week. The whitish panels on the upperwings are quite pronounced in these pics. And the underparts are mostly visible in the lower pic. To see the features up close, just double-click on each pic (including those in the previous post). Be aware that the quality diminishes as this bird was over 150 feet when I photographed it so I have already enlarged the pics. Also be aware that there was no rufous on this bird-if any reddish tones appear in the pics this is an artifact of enlarging them so much. SeEtta
